Tummy Tuck Surgery Creates Positive Change in Your Appearance

Friday, February 5th, 2010

Abdominoplasty surgery, also referred to as a tummy tuck surgery, is a plastic surgery procedure designed to remove the excess fat tissue, trim and tighten the the abdominal skin and tighten the muscles of the abdomen in the mid to lower abdominal region providing a trim, fit looking mid section.

For women who have had more than one pregnancy, often times experience sagging skin in the abdominal region due to the skin stretching as the belly gets larger during pregnancy. When performing this plastic surgery procedure, the plastic surgeon lifts away the sagging skin, and stretches the skin downward toward the pelvis. The plastic surgeon will remove the excess skin, and the scar will generally rest at the “bikini line.” At this time, the surgeon will also remove excess fat tissues and tighten the abdominal muscles using stitches. In many cases, the abdominoplasty, or tummy tuck procedure requires moving the position of the navel upwards to compensate for lost abdominal skin. This procedure is often performed in combination with a liposuction surgery procedure of the thighs, hips love handles to enhance the overall result.

Santa Monica – Tummy Tuck

Tuesday, February 2nd, 2010

Should you be considering a tummy tuck? Honestly, only a qualified surgeon can definitively answer that question. There are some generally applicable details, though, that are useful to know about tummy tucks (also called abdominoplasty). Santa Monica Abdominoplasty

Abdominoplasty is not a weight loss procedure. It can be useful once the weight is lost, but the best tummy tuck candidates are already in relatively good shape and simply have a fat deposit or loose abdominal skin that isn’t responding to diet and exercise. The abdominal wall muscles are tightened as part of an abdominoplasty, making the procedure particularly beneficial to women who, through pregnancy, have stretched their bodies beyond its ability to fully recover. This also makes a tummy tuck one of the most “uncomfortable” procedures, usually requiring a hospital stay during recovery. The level of scarring depends on how extensive the procedure is. Incisions are made in inconspicuous real estate, but it’s safe to say that if you have skin excised, there will be a scar.

Generally an elective procedure, abdominoplasty shares at least thing in common with all surgery; there is the risk of complication. An honest conversation with your plastic surgeon is an important step toward knowing all you face. Body Contouring Procedures Like Abdominoplasty And Lipoplasty Are Performed To Create A Better Contour

Tuesday, January 26th, 2010

A lipoplasty procedure is performed to remove localized areas of fat that surround the abdomen, upper arms, buttocks, hips, thighs, neck, calves, and knees. People who receive lipoplasty surgery are usually looking for an improvement in the contours of their figure – both in and out of their clothing. The plastic surgery procedure itself is performed with a thin metal tube called a cannula. The cannula is inserted beneath the patient’s skin and it’s used to vacuum the fat away from certain irregular contours around one’s body.

Is Body Contouring Surgery Right for You?

Wednesday, January 20th, 2010

Body contouring surgery involves removal of fat tissues, rearranging the skin and tightening muscles in order to create a more youthful appearance. The plastic surgeon utilizes different techniques to achieve a unique, lasting aesthetic result custom tailored for each patient. Your plastic surgeon will work closely with you to develop a surgical approach that is optimal for you. The following includes information about the two main body contouring procedures.

Liposuction surgery is a procedures that involves the removal of fat from problem areas of the body such as love handles. Liposuction procedures can be performed alone, or in combination with other body contouring procedures. Patients who are excellent candidates for liposuction have pockets of fat that do not respond to regular exercise and proper diet. For Liposuction surgery, the Best results are achieved when the fat is localized to specific problem areas and the patients has good skin tone.

Abdominoplasty surgery, also referred to as a tummy tuck, is a procedure designed to tighten the loose and/or hanging skin of the abdomen, hips, and pubic area. Patients who have loose or sagging skin around the abdomen and softened abdominal wall muscles are excellent candidates for an abdominoplasty procedure. In some cases, a patient may also suffer from abdominal bulges and hernias. These problems can be treated effectively in conjunction with an abdominoplasty surgery procedure.
